Types of Equipment and Technologies Used in Military Search and Rescue Support

Advanced communication systems are fundamental to military search and rescue support operations. These include encrypted radios and satellite communication devices that enable reliable contact in remote or hostile environments, ensuring seamless coordination among rescue teams and command units.

Specialized navigation and positioning technologies such as GPS and inertial navigation systems are vital for locating missing personnel accurately. These tools facilitate efficient search patterns and assist rescuers in navigating challenging terrains like dense forests, mountainous regions, or open water.

Rescue equipment includes high-tech devices like thermal imaging cameras, which detect heat signatures of individuals in obscured or low-visibility conditions, significantly increasing rescue success rates. Alongside, data transmission towers and drone technology enhance area surveillance and aid in mapping difficult terrains.

Furthermore, rescue personnel utilize various life-support systems, including portable oxygen devices, first aid kits equipped with advanced medical supplies, and deployable shelters. These tools ensure immediate care and sustain rescued individuals until further assistance is available, underscoring the importance of specialized equipment in military search and rescue support.

Challenges and Environmental Factors in Military Search and Rescue Support

Military Search and Rescue support faces numerous challenges arising from diverse environmental factors. These factors significantly influence the planning, execution, and safety of rescue missions. Harsh weather conditions, such as storms, snow, or extreme heat, can impede visibility, mobility, and communication.

Difficult terrains like mountains, dense forests, and maritime environments further complicate rescue efforts. These environments often limit access and pose risks to both rescue personnel and victims. Unpredictable environmental changes can alter safety dynamics unexpectedly.

Operational environments also introduce hazards such as radiation, chemical contamination, or unexploded ordnance, requiring specialized equipment and protocols. Navigating through these dangerous conditions demands high skill levels and meticulous risk management to ensure mission success and crew safety.

Overall, environmental factors represent a constant challenge in military search and rescue support, necessitating adaptable strategies and robust training to overcome unpredictable conditions effectively.

Future Trends and Innovations in Military Search and Rescue Support Dynamics

Emerging technologies are set to transform military search and rescue support operations significantly. Advances in drone technology, including autonomous UAVs, enable rapid deployment and real-time aerial surveillance, which enhances search efficiency in challenging terrains. These innovations reduce response times and increase mission success rates.

Artificial intelligence (AI) and machine learning are increasingly integrated into rescue systems, facilitating predictive analytics, threat assessment, and decision-making under pressure. AI-powered algorithms can analyze environmental data to identify probable rescue zones, optimizing resource allocation and safety protocols.

Furthermore, the development of wearable sensors and exoskeletons offers increased safety and endurance for rescue personnel. These innovations provide vital health metrics and assist physical tasks, enabling responders to operate more effectively in hostile or hazardous conditions.

Overall, the future of military search and rescue support is poised for substantial growth in technological integration, improving capabilities and operational safety. Staying ahead with these innovations ensures missions are more precise, efficient, and adaptable to evolving battlefield environments.
